Large Meter Testing
We test production, wholesale, and commercial meters to uncover inaccuracies and support efficient billing. Using in-situ comparative methods with certified test meters or our Polcon® Pitot Rod, we help utilities create cost-effective testing schedules and provide repairs and calibration in line with AWWA standards.
Bench Testing
We provide controlled-environment testing for meters 1″ and smaller, including inspection and bleed-off valve procedures to ensure accurate performance.

Water Audits
Our six-phase water audit follows AWWA guidelines to identify both apparent and real losses across your system. The process includes supply analysis, control plan development, performance indicators, and a detailed review of authorized consumption—giving you a full picture of where and how water is being lost.
Water Audit Validations
We provide Level 1 validations to confirm the accuracy of your water audit before regulatory submission, ensuring your data meets required standards and builds trust inyour reported results.
